apparently some h97 boards will allow overclocking on unlocked cpus, depending on the bios. but its not a good idea since h97 boards were not meant for overclocking. either run the 4690k stock(you may not have a choice anyway on that board) or get a z97 board.

as for coolers under 50 bucks, the h7 is definitely the way to go. at 35 bucks or so it really cant be beat in that price range. I had an overclocked 6600k cooled by one and it did an excellent job.
